According to UN researchers, artificial intelligence will double data center energy and water consumption by 2030.

SINGAPORE, June 3 (Reuters) - Data centres will consume twice as much electricity and water by 2030 as they expand to meet soaring demand from artificial intelligence, U.N. researchers predict.

If governments fail to consider the growing environmental costs of AI, its rapid adoption could also deplete limited land resources and generate massive amounts of e-waste, warns a report from the United Nations University's Institute for Water, Environment and Health.

Here are some key findings:

• Last year, data centers consumed 448 terawatt-hours of electricity worldwide, more than all of Saudi Arabia. Artificial intelligence accounted for a fifth of that.

• They also consumed 4.5 trillion liters of water, enough to meet the needs of more than 600 million people in sub-Saharan Africa, while emitting 189 million tons of carbon dioxide.

• «In public debates, AI is often still thought of as software, but AI is also physical infrastructure: data centers, power generation, cooling systems, transmission networks, chips, minerals, land and water,» said Kaveh Madani, director of the institute and lead author of the report.

• By 2030, annual data center electricity consumption is projected to double to 945 TWh, roughly the same as Japan as a whole, with AI accounting for 401 TWh of the total.

• Water consumption is expected to reach 9.3 trillion liters and CO2 emissions will rise to 399 million tons.

• The land area used for data centers is projected to increase from 6,900 square kilometers (2,664 square miles) last year to more than 14,500 square kilometers by 2030, according to the report.

• While AI can improve efficiency by optimizing power grids and reducing waste, overall demand for electricity and water will likely still rise as countries and corporations seek to build new capacity.

• «At the moment, the competition for faster growth is overshadowing the most basic principles of sustainable development,» Madani added.

• "AI won't simply "dry out" globally due to water or power shortages. But in some places, poorly planned data center expansion could collide with existing resource shortages. That's why responsible planning is important now, before infrastructure and dependencies become insurmountable.".
